UK Government Allocates £5 Billion to Defense Plan for Drone and AI Development Over 4 Years

According to market sources, the UK government will launch a defense investment plan allocating approximately £5 billion over the next four years to develop unmanned systems and accelerate the integration of artificial intelligence and autonomous systems within its armed forces to enhance capability in modern warfare.
